Tik Tok . Job Description The Project Director leads strategic
execution of prioritized Neuroscience Discovery programs in a
matrixed environment,. The successful candidate will advance
programs supporting neurodegeneration, movement disorders, migraine
and psychiatric indications. This global role requires
collaboration across sites in Illinois, Massachusetts, and Germany,
with travel required to interface directly with teams. The position
serves as the key point of contact at the program level with
decision-making authority on project strategies. Responsibilities :
